The Chicago Rock Gods / Dutch Super-Group: GENE YAAS had their first ever Chicago performance - Last night(18th June, 2008) at Elbo Room.
It was a rather rousing success!
With a significant fan presence - and enthusiastic reception and response to their peculiar brand of hard-pop-rock.
Their powerfully silly and catchy tunes went over well.
Katheter's lead singer: Zach Hubeck rounded out the second half of their set with a handful of band and fan favorites.
Zach performed brilliantly - and injected extra excitement and energy to the show's climactic finale!
The rest of the GENE YAAS line-up consisted of: Marty Hitzeman(Gene Maarteen) on Guitar and lead vocals; Phil Blus(Philippus Van Yaas) on drums and backing vocals; Brian Weder(Bartel Weit) on Bass; and newest member, Keith Briscoe(Stijn Kolbus) on second and occasional lead guitar.
